Looking back to the past decade from now, technical teams did not pay much attention to the user experience when creating any software products or applications. They would design their software based on their technical expertise. Code logic has its limitations because UI is not their prime concern. But, it is now an essential factor that is used to assess the performance of any tech product or solution. Today, the tech world revolves around the user-first approach. Since the users are going to use the applications, their preferences matter the most. Therefore, they will choose products or services that offer a decent user experience, if not great.
Every software is built for several distinct users with varyings needs and expectations. It is challenging for developers to build applications that perfectly match the requirements of every user. That said, they can ensure the seamless performance of software applications across all devices, operating systems, and browsers. To do so, developers must have functional dimensions that help in assessing the performance of each application feature. Direct feedback helps to create the right business logic, which leads to deliberate UI development. That is why the software development process requires a UI test automation environment. Setting up a UI test framework can be tricky as every business has its unique specifications and requirements. The main obstacle to incorporating business systems into one environment is to apportion them.
Principles To Keep In Mind While Developing A Ui Test Automation Strategy
Skilled Engineers Are As Important As Automation Tools
It is advisable to invest in an automation tool. Choosing the right tool for your business needs will speed up your experimental endeavors. It allows 24/7 quality checks to confirm direct bug detection. Tech giants and advisory companies emphasize the importance of testing applications based on real-world conditions other than user requirements. Moreover, the automation devices enable reusability that prevents teams from writing the same code again and again. It has better distribution test implementation and creates more comprehensive test coverage. However, if you think that only automation tools can help you navigate complex QA requirements, think again.
Skilled professionals are equally essential. Compare your automation device to a train. Like a good driver is needed to operate the train efficiently, you need proficient QA engineers who can accomplish the automation process effectively. However, there is a small catch. You should invest in tools that are suitable as per the expertise of your team to ensure high productivity and prompt results.
Three Levels of UI Test Automation
A great idea when designing UI level functional tests is to think about describing testing and automation using the below-mentioned three levels:
- Functionality Level
What this test displays or exercises. For example, customers who order two or more books will be offered free delivery. - User Interface Workflow Level
What the user needs to do to work through the UI at the highest performance level. For example, put two books in the shopping cart, then enter the address details and check out whether it offers free delivery in the delivery options. - Technical Activity Level
What are the technical steps required to implement the functionality. For example, open up the shop homepage, sign/log in with “test user” and “test password”, move to the “book” page, click on the first image with the “book” CSS class, wait until the page loads, and click on the “buy now” link and so forth.
To know more about How To Implement Effective UI Testing - click here
Article source: https://article-realm.com/article/Transportation/16439-How-To-Implement-Effective-UI-Testing.html
Reviews
Comments
Most Recent Articles
- Mar 19, 2024 Catamaran Market Size, Share & Growth Analysis 2024-2032 by Nathan lyonn
- Mar 18, 2024 Automotive Testing & Inspection Market Size, Industry Share & Trends | Report 2024-32 by Nathan lyonn
- Mar 18, 2024 Automotive Control Arm Market Size, Growth, Insights | Forecast 2024-2032 by Nathan lyonn
- Mar 18, 2024 Automotive Cockpit Modules Market Size, Industry Trends & Research Report 2024-32 by Nathan lyonn
- Mar 15, 2024 Aircraft Refueling Trucks Market Size, Emerging Trends & Forecast 2024-32 by Nathan lyonn
Most Viewed Articles
- 76865 hits The Latest Online Business by Andrea Smith Jones
- 1772 hits How To Succeed At Internet Marketing by Administrator
- 1759 hits properly 5 suggestions for the best press releases: Get to the appropriate with Google in 2018 by nisse lind
- 1507 hits Three Basic Steps to Search Engine Optimization by Smith Smithsson
- 1488 hits The Main Reasons To Get In Touch With An Android App Design Company by Guest
Popular Articles
In today’s competitive world, one must be knowledgeable about the latest online business that works effectively through seo services....
76865 Views
Are you caught in between seo companies introduced by a friend, researched by you, or advertised by a particular site? If that is the...
31906 Views
Walmart is being sued by a customer alleging racial discrimination. The customer who has filed a lawsuit against the retailer claims that it...
12028 Views
If you have an idea for a new product, you can start by performing a patent search. This will help you decide whether your idea could become the...
10195 Views
Statistics
Members | |
---|---|
Members: | 13874 |
Publishing | |
---|---|
Articles: | 58,269 |
Categories: | 202 |
Online | |
---|---|
Active Users: | 726 |
Members: | 7 |
Guests: | 719 |
Bots: | 2991 |
Visits last 24h (live): | 3889 |
Visits last 24h (bots): | 18379 |